(May 16, 2005) - Fordham University freshman Cory Riordan (Killingworth, CT/Haddam-Killingworth) earned Atlantic 10 Baseball Co-Rookie of the Week honors for the week ending May 15th. This is the third straight week Riordan has been honored as rookie of the week, while also garnering co-pitcher of the week honors last week.
In his lone start of the week, Riordan threw seven scoreless innings, allowing just four hits and striking out eight in Fordham's 6-0 win over Saint Joseph's on Sunday. The win was the tenth of the season for Riordan, becoming the first Ram pitcher to win at least ten games since Paul Darrigo in 1988. He also extended his consecutive scoreless innings streak to 23 innings.
On the year, Riordan is 10-3 with a 3.46 earned run average and 59 strikeouts in 80.2 innings.
The Fordham Baseball team, ranked 10th in the Northeast Region, is currently 33-18 overall, 17-7 in the Atlantic 10. The 17 conference wins is the most by Fordham since joining the Atlantic 10 in 1995-96, and the Rams will be the number three seed at next week's Atlantic 10 Championship.
